Strategy-to-execution operating model linking funding gates to team cadence

Strategy-to-execution operating model linking funding gates to team cadence

How to turn executive intent into funded, timeboxed team work that actually ships

Most strategy documents die in the gap between the quarterly planning meeting and the first sprint. Leadership walks out of a room feeling aligned. Teams walk into the next week with a vague sense of what "matters this quarter" and no real change to how they allocate hours. Six weeks later, someone runs a status update, discovers three of the top priorities have zero funded work behind them, and everyone acts surprised.

That gap isn't a communication problem. It's a plumbing problem. The connective tissue between what leadership decides and what teams actually fund with their time is missing or broken. And when it breaks, OKRs become a performance — something you write down, review once, and quietly abandon.

A strategy to execution operating model is the set of routines, gates, and enforcement rules that convert executive intent into funded, timeboxed delivery. Not a slide. A wiring diagram. This piece walks through how that wiring works when it's healthy, where it snaps under scale, and how to build it so quarterly intent reliably becomes team-week reality.

Where the intent-to-work chain actually breaks

Think of the chain as four handoffs: intent → funding → cadence → verification. Executives set intent. Someone funds it (assigns capacity and money). Teams schedule it into cadence (sprints, weeks). And a verification loop confirms the funded work is producing the outcome. Most orgs have all four concepts but no connective mechanism between them.

The pattern plays out the same way almost everywhere. Intent gets set clearly enough. Funding is where it falls apart — because "funding" in most companies isn't an explicit act. Nobody says "we are allocating 40% of Team A's capacity to Objective 2 for the next quarter." Instead, priorities get communicated, and teams are trusted to self-allocate. Self-allocation drifts toward whatever is loudest: the escalations, the exec's pet request, the customer who complained on Slack.

So you end up with a strategy that looks funded on paper and is completely unfunded in the calendar. The objective everyone agreed was #1 has three engineers assigned part-time between two firefights. Meanwhile a "nice to have" absorbed a full team because it had a vocal sponsor.

A typical example: a 60-person product org sets four quarterly objectives. When you audit where hours actually went at the end of the quarter, roughly half of engineering capacity landed on unplanned work and interrupts. The stated top objective got somewhere around 18% of real capacity. Nobody decided that. It just happened, one reprioritization at a time.

Why funding never becomes explicit

There are a few reasons this handoff stays broken across almost every company size.

The first is that funding feels like it happens elsewhere. Leadership assumes when they approve headcount, they're funding strategy. But headcount is a standing cost — it doesn't map to objectives. A team of eight can pursue any of a dozen directions with the same payroll. Approving the team is not the same as directing the team.

The second is that timeboxing and funding live in different tools and different conversations. Finance thinks in quarters and dollars. Teams think in sprints and story points. Nobody translates between the two units. So "we're investing in retention this quarter" never becomes "Team C dedicates sprints 1–4 to retention with a check-in at sprint 2."

The third is fear of commitment. Explicit funding forces trade-offs to be visible. If you say Objective 1 gets 40% and Objective 3 gets 10%, the sponsor of Objective 3 sees exactly how deprioritized they are. Vague allocation avoids that conflict — which is why leaders unconsciously prefer it. The cost is that the conflict just moves downstream, into the team's week, where it gets resolved by whoever escalates hardest.

What breaks specifically as you scale

At 10–15 people, none of this matters much. The founder or a lead holds the whole map in their head and rebalances in real time. Intent and execution are basically the same conversation.

The wiring starts failing around three transitions:

  1. When one team becomes many. Cross-team dependencies mean funding Objective 1 now requires coordinated funding across three teams. If Team A funds it and Team B doesn't, the objective stalls at the handoff. This is where you need something like the ownership and escalation structure covered in the cross-team dependency governance blueprint — because uncoordinated funding produces beautifully staffed work that dies waiting on an unstaffed dependency.
  2. When quarters get long enough to drift. A 13-week quarter has six or seven sprints. Intent set in week one erodes by week five. Without a gate that re-checks funding mid-quarter, you're steering by a decision that's already stale.
  3. When the number of objectives exceeds working memory. Past four or five funded objectives, no single person tracks whether each still has real capacity behind it. The org needs an artifact that shows funded-vs-actual allocation, or it flies blind.

The failure mode at scale isn't dramatic. It's quiet. Work still happens, people stay busy, sprints still close. It just gradually decouples from strategy until the end-of-quarter review reveals that effort and intent went in completely different directions.

The operating model: gates, mappings, and enforcement

The fix is a small number of explicit routines that force funding to become a real, visible act — and keep it honest across the quarter. Four pieces.

1. Funding-rule templates

> Objective X receives [%] of [Team]'s delivery capacity for [time window], with a mandatory review at [gate].

A worked funding table for one team's quarter might look like this:

ObjectiveFunded capacityTime windowGate
Reduce onboarding drop-off40%Sprints 1–4Gate at sprint 2
Billing reliability25%Sprints 1–6Gate at sprint 3
Partner API v220%Sprints 3–6Gate at sprint 4
Reserved (interrupts/unplanned)15%Whole quarterContinuous

Notice the reserved band. Teams that fund objectives to 100% and leave nothing for interrupts always overrun, and the interrupts silently eat funded work. Naming a reserve makes the raid visible when it happens.

2. Quarter→sprint mapping routine

This is the translation layer between finance-language and team-language, and it's where most operating models are simply absent. The routine runs once at quarter start and gets refreshed at each gate:

  1. Restate each objective as a measurable outcome — the thing that has to move, not the activity. "Cut onboarding drop-off from ~35% to under 25%," not "improve onboarding."
  2. Assign a funding percentage using the template above. Force the numbers to sum to 100% including the reserve. If they don't sum, you haven't actually decided.
  3. Convert percentages into sprint slots. If Objective 1 is 40% of a team's capacity across four sprints, that's roughly two engineers' worth of committed work per sprint. Write it into the sprint plan as named, owned work — not aspiration.
  4. Place the gates on the calendar. Each objective gets a mid-window checkpoint where funding is re-authorized, adjusted, or cut. Gates go on the shared calendar as real events with a required decision, not a status readout.
  5. Publish the map. One page, visible to leadership and teams. This is the document that gets audited at each gate.

The operational roadmap approach to mapping strategic outcomes into a repeatable cadence pairs directly with this — the roadmap gives you the outcomes; this routine attaches funded capacity to them.

3. Gate checklists

A gate is a scheduled decision point where funded work must justify its continued funding. It is not a demo. The whole point is that a gate can defund something. If your gates can't cut funding, they're just meetings.

  1. Outcome movement

    Has the target metric moved in the expected direction? By roughly how much versus what was projected at funding time?

  2. Actual vs funded capacity

    Did this objective actually receive its committed percentage, or did interrupts eat it? If it never got funded, don't judge it as if it did.

  3. Blocking dependencies

    Is anything waiting on an unfunded cross-team dependency? If so, that's a funding gap upstream, not a delivery failure here.

  4. Continue / adjust / cut decision

    An explicit, recorded call. Reduce funding, hold, boost, or stop. "Keep going" counts only if someone says it out loud and it's written down.

  5. Reallocation

    If you cut or reduced, where does the freed capacity go? Freed capacity that isn't reassigned just evaporates into interrupts.

The dashboard that feeds these gates is worth building deliberately — the signals and thresholds in portfolio observability that actually drives funding are exactly what a gate needs to make a real cut instead of a polite nod.

4. Enforcement scripts

The operating model only holds if someone enforces the funding boundaries against the daily pull of escalations. Enforcement is mostly a set of scripts — short, repeatable responses that protect funded work without turning every request into a fight.

> "This is unfunded for this quarter. To fund it, we pull capacity from one of these objectives — which one comes down, and who signs off on that trade?"

That single sentence does most of the work. It converts a vague "can you also do this" into an explicit trade with a named owner. Nine times out of ten the request evaporates because nobody wants to own the trade. When it survives, it deserved the funding, and now it has it explicitly.

A real scenario

A mid-size B2B software company — around 45 people across five teams — kept ending quarters with the same complaint from leadership: "we set clear priorities and none of them moved." When they audited a completed quarter, the top objective — reducing enterprise churn — had received somewhere between 15–20% of real engineering capacity, despite being "the #1 priority." The rest disappeared into support escalations and two loud internal stakeholders.

They didn't add tools or headcount. They added the four routines above. Each of the three quarterly objectives got an explicit funded percentage per team, translated into named sprint work, with two gates per objective on the calendar. New requests hit the trade script.

The next quarter wasn't magically clean. Interrupts still happened — the reserved band got raided twice, and one objective got formally defunded at its first gate because the metric wasn't moving and the team was clearly better spent elsewhere. But the churn objective went from roughly 18% real capacity to something north of 35%, because it was funded on paper and protected in the calendar. Enterprise churn moved for the first time in three quarters. The bigger cultural shift was that "we should do X" stopped being a valid sentence unless it came with "instead of what."

When this operating model makes sense — and when it doesn't

When it's worth it:

  1. You have three or more teams whose work has to coordinate around shared objectives.
  2. Quarters routinely end with a gap between stated priorities and where hours actually went.
  3. Escalations and loud stakeholders regularly override the plan without anyone deciding they should.
  4. Leadership sets intent but has no visibility into whether it's funded until the quarter's over.

When it's a bad idea:

  1. You're under 10–12 people and one person already holds the whole allocation map in their head. Adding gates and funding tables is pure overhead; you'll spend more time maintaining the model than steering with it.
  2. Your work is genuinely reactive by nature — an incident-response or pure-support team — where "funding objectives in advance" fights the actual job. These teams need capacity buffers and triage discipline, not quarterly funding gates.
  3. Leadership isn't willing to let gates actually cut things. If every gate is a rubber stamp, the whole model is theater and you're better off not pretending.

Who should NOT run this: an org where nobody has the authority to enforce trades. The trade script only works if the person saying it can make the trade stick. If enforcement gets overruled every time a VP escalates, the model erodes in a single quarter and you've taught everyone that funding is negotiable — which is worse than where you started.

Rolling it out without a big-bang launch

Don't convert the whole org at once. The rollout that tends to hold:

  1. Pick one team and one quarter. Run the full model — funding table, sprint mapping, gates, trade script — on a single team as a pilot. Keep it visible.
  2. Instrument funded-vs-actual from day one. The single most convincing artifact is the gap between what you funded and where capacity actually went. That number is what sells the model to the rest of the org.
  3. Run the first two gates strictly. Actually cut or reduce something at a gate. If the first gates are toothless, the pilot proves nothing.
  4. Debrief with the funded-vs-actual data, not opinions. Show leadership where their intent did and didn't translate. This is the moment the model earns its expansion.
  5. Expand to teams that share dependencies with the pilot next — not random teams — so the coordinated-funding benefit shows up quickly.

The mistake is rolling out the artifacts (tables, gates, checklists) without the enforcement. Plenty of orgs adopt a funding template, publish it, and never protect it. Three weeks later it's a stale doc nobody looks at. The template is the easy part. The trade script and the willingness to defund things at a gate — that's what actually converts intent into delivery.

The real shift

The point of a strategy to execution operating model isn't more process. It's making one specific act — funding — explicit and visible, so that trade-offs get decided by people with authority instead of resolved by whoever escalates loudest in a given week.

When funding is implicit, strategy is a wish. When it's explicit, timeboxed, and protected by gates and trade scripts, strategy becomes a schedule. The teams that consistently ship against their objectives aren't the ones with better strategy documents — they're the ones where "this is our priority" reliably shows up as funded capacity in someone's actual sprint, and stays there because someone was willing to protect it.
